Filter convergence and decompositions for vector lattice-valued measures

Abstract: Filter convergence of vector lattice-valued measures is considered, in order to deduce theorems of convergence for their decompositions. First the -additive case is studied, without particular assumptions on the filter; later the finitely additive case is faced, first assuming uniform -boundedness (without restrictions on the filter), then relaxing this condition but imposing stronger properties on the filter. In order to obtain the last results, a Schur-type convergence theorem is used.
